I've enjoyed watching the videos over at StampTV for awhile now.  Recently they started having sketch & color challenge videos each week in addition to their technique videos.  This week I decided to play along with this week's sketch challenge (STVSKSP9)...have you guessed yet that I love sketch challenges?  :) Here's the card I entered for the challenge.

I used Ollie Owl on the outside of my card.  I received the Forest Branches embossing folder for Christmas and haven't had a chance to use it until now.  I just thought this owl and the branches were a perfect match for each other.  Jute just seems to go with the whole forest theme too. 





Supplies:
Cardstock - Paper Studio, Georgia Pacific, Recollections
Paper - AdornIt (Fern Collection)
Stamps - Sweet 'n Sassy (Owl Occasions & Ollie Owl)
Ink - Memento (Tuxedo Black)
Embellishments - Jute & button from my stash, Prismacolor pencils, Art Studio blender
Tools - Spellbinders Nestabilities (Petite Oval Large, Petite Scalloped Oval Large, Circles Large, Lacey Circles), Cuttlebug embossing folder (Forest Branches)
